The article explains the decline in the rate of Syrians returning from host countries, especially after the initial phase which saw approximately 1.8 million voluntary returns since December 2024, following the fall of the previous regime in Syria. Measures have been implemented to facilitate returns in Jordan and Turkey, including extending crossing hours at Jaber-Nassib border and providing financial assistance to enable returnees. Despite continued significant movement, seasonal factors, security, and service conditions in Syria influence the decision to return, with a notable decrease after the beginning of 2026. Currently, around 9 million Syrians remain outside the country. Conditions of stability and access to services are among the main factors affecting the ongoing return of refugees, with the current phase characterized by gradual and uneven progress.
